气体类传感器基础

1.ppm(part per million)百万分之一

ppb(part per billion)10亿分之一

ppt(part per trillion)万亿分之一

ppt(part per thousand)千分之一

它们本来是无量纲的量,如果想知道它们是何种含义,还要清楚它们是体积比还是质量比等。1ug/ml质量和体积比。

对气体而言,会更复杂一些,因为气体混合时,在不同的压力,温湿度下,各组份的变化不是理想的。

2.通常空气中所含污染物的浓度是以单位体积内所含污染物的质量来表示,即mg/m3或ug/m3。而ppm可以理解为在1000000个单位体积的空气中气体污染物的体积数是多少。一下简单的计算,排除了温湿度,大气压等干扰的影响。

3.%LEL:是的是爆炸下线,当可燃气体达到100%LEL时极易发生爆炸,所以0~100%LEL一般是指测可燃气体的量产。

4.%VOL:体积比,比如一个空间中,有多少氧气。

5.SO2是形成酸雨的主要原因,当大气中的浓度达到4ppm时,就会被闻到,浓度到达8~12ppm时,会引发咳嗽,达到20ppm时,眼睛会流泪。当环境中的SO2浓度大于150ppb的临界浓度时,就会对高等植物产生伤害。

6.气体以检测对象可划分为:可燃气体气敏传感器,如氢气,甲烷,煤气;有毒有害气敏传感器,如CO,NO2,SO2;环境控制类气敏传感器,如温湿度,烟雾;

7.

8.

电阻型气体传感器的常用电路分析

时间: 2024-10-06 20:57:45

气体类传感器基础的相关文章

图解Python 【第五篇】:面向对象-类-初级基础篇

由于类的内容比较多,分为类-初级基础篇和类-进阶篇 类的内容总览图: 本节内容一览图: 今天只讲类的基础的面向对象的特性 前言总结介绍: 面向对象是一种编程方式,此编程方式的实现是基于对 类 和 对象 的使用 类 是一个模板,模板中包装了多个"函数"供使用(可以讲多函数中公用的变量封装到对象中) 对象,根据模板创建的实例(即:对象),实例用于调用被包装在类中的函数,对象是一个类的实例 实例(instance):一个对象的实例化实现. 标识(identity):每个对象的实例都需要一个可

Python全栈开发记录_第九篇(类的基础_封装_继承_多态)

有点时间没更新博客了,今天就开始学习类了,今天主要是类的基础篇,我们知道面向对象的三大特性,那就是封装,继承和多态.内容参考该博客https://www.cnblogs.com/wupeiqi/p/4493506.html 之前我们写的都是函数,可以说是面向过程的编程,需要啥功能就直接写啥,但是我们在编写程序的过程中会发现如果多个函数有共同的参数或数据时,我们也必须多次重复去写,此时如果用面向对象的编程方式就会好很多,这也是面向对象的适用场景. 面向对象三大特性: 一.封装(顾名思义就是将内容封

OC笔记:类的基础知识及代码示例

类 1.类的定义: 类=属性+方法: -属性代表类的特征 -方法是类能对变化做出的反应 类定义的格式:类的声明和类的实现组成 -接口(类的声明):@interface 类名:基类的名字 .类名首字母要大写 .冒号表示继承关系,冒号后面的是类的父类 .NSObject是OC所有类的基类 .类的声明放在“类名+.h”文件中,要由两部分组成:实例变量和方法 -实现(类的实现):@implementation类名 .方法实现 -都用@end结束c 2.类的使用: OC中,对象通过指针来声明   如:Cl

类的基础操作

使用面向对象编程,使程序结构化,基础学习下,类的简单实例过程: Person:     (,name,age):         .Name=name         .Age=age     __talk():         name():         % .Name     ():         __name__==:     p=Person(,)p.name()     p._Person__talk()

Java——常用类(基础类型数据包装类)

[包装类] 包装类(如Integer.Double等)这些类封装了一个相应的基础数据类型数值,并为其提供了一系列操作. 例如:java.lang.Integer类提供了以下构造方法: Integer(int value) Integer(String s) [常用方法] [程序分析] 注:<1>对于int i=100;而言分配在栈上:对于Integer i = new Integer(100)分配在堆中. <2>注意异常的捕获和处理必不可少.

c++关于类的基础学习

类 :在c++中大体分为两种,一 内置类型,如int double用户等  二 用户自定义类UDT        问:为什么要使用用户自定义类?        答:编译器不可能知道我们想使用的全部类型.但是标准库类型已经给我们提供了一些非常有用的类,比如vector,string,ostream等等,但是远不能满足需求.尤其是在面向对象的程序设计中,我们需要用自定义的一个类型独立的去表示这个对象的一些特性,所以在面向对象的程序中我们看到更多的是一个一个的对象,而在c程序中我们看到更多的是函数和表

《大话设计模式》笔记-基础知识1:UML类图基础知识

好多计算机技术书籍或者文章中常用到UML类图,本书作者介绍每一种设计模式就是用类图+面向对象语言小程序(用的C#,其基础知识另文介绍)+人物对话解释知识点.本文就是介绍<大话设计模式>中所用到UML类图的基础知识. 上图是一个整体的图,特别要注意各种样式的箭头,下文分别用局部小图说明各知识点. 类 类图分三层: (1)      类名称,如果是抽象类就用斜体标识.本例,类名称是"动物",且其是一个抽象类. (2)      类特性,通常是字段和属性.本例,类特性是"

java多线程系类:基础篇:04synchronized关键字

概要 本章,会对synchronized关键字进行介绍.涉及到的内容包括:1. synchronized原理2. synchronized基本规则3. synchronized方法 和 synchronized代码块4. 实例锁 和 全局锁 转载请注明出处:http://www.cnblogs.com/skywang12345/p/3479202.html 1. synchronized原理 在java中,每一个对象有且仅有一个同步锁.这也意味着,同步锁是依赖于对象而存在.当我们调用某对象的sy

python 类的基础知识

1.创建类 1 class Book(object): 2 def __init__(self,b): #定义构造器 3 self.name=b 4 print self.name 5 def updatename(self,a): 6 self.name=a 7 print self.name 注意: __init__()在实例化时被调用(隐式调用). self参数自动由解释器传递  . 2.创建实例(类的实例化) 1 c=Book('mike') 注意: 创建类实例时,注意传参的个数.例如上